The first three books are from the Black Dogs Motorcycle Club: Sanctum-Jase and Maggie. Retribution- Will and Eva. Vindication- Ghost and Bridget. Each book incorporates a separate couple, the trials of the club and life, with plenty of sex scenes, violence and pinches of humour. Collectively, for 99p, they weren't a bad buy...not brilliant but readable...Unlike the fourth separate book ' The Desperados'. Had I have read this trash first I wouldn't have bothered with the rest...in fact, I couldn't get beyond a few chapters...it certainly spoiled this box set.
